Why is jellied cranberry sauce upside down?

Supermarkets: Why are cans of cranberry packed and labeled upside down? – Quora. According to Ocean Spray, making the can with the rounded end of the can at the top (making the top of the can the bottom) is so that there is an air bubble inside to aid in the sauce releasing itself and sliding out of the can.

Is cranberry sauce the same as cranberry jelly?

In my experience, 'cranberry jelly' is a clearer version of cranberry sauce, with a texture something like that of gelatin. Cranberry sauce contains whole berries and parts of whole berries. Sometimes it's firm, like gelatin; at other times it's softer — like applesauce, perhaps.

What are the ingredients in canned cranberry sauce?

On the back of canned cranberry sauce you will find a short list of ingredients, generally cranberries, corn syrup (sometimes normal and high fructose), water, and citric acid (a preservative).

Can I freeze cranberry sauce?

Can You Freeze Homemade Cranberry Sauce? Homemade cranberry sauce freezes beautifully. Pack homemade cranberry sauce in an airtight container or freezer-safe plastic bag to prevent freezer burn. For best results, use the frozen cranberry sauce within a couple of months, and defrost in the refrigerator overnight.

How many cups is 12 oz of cranberries?

A 12-oz bag of cranberries = approximately 3 cups of berries. A 12-oz bag of cranberries = approximately 2 1/4 cups of “chopped” berries. One serving = 1/2 cup fresh berries.

How is canned cranberry sauce made?

One of the most popular brands of canned cranberry sauce is, of course, Ocean Spray. Their jellied cranberry sauce is made with cranberries, high fructose corn syrup, corn syrup, and water. As cranberries, sugar, and water boil, the cranberries pop and release all their pectin into the mixture.
